Additive Orthopaedics 3d printed Locking Lattice Plates
The Additive Orthopaedics Locking Lattice system is intended to be used for alignment, stabilization and fusion of fractures, osteotomies and arthrodesis of small bones such as the foot and ankle.












FEATURES
- 3D printed Ti6Al4V Titanium ELI
- Rough bottom surface for boney on-growth
- Smooth/Polished Top Surface
- Anatomic and Low Profile
- Biologics Channel
- Center hole for connection to several AO 3D printed bone segments
- 3.0mm locking screws, multiple lengths
- 3.0mm non-locking screws, multiple lengths

GAME PLAN ® by Additive Orthopaedics
Powering our patient specific implants, Game Plan is an end-to-end fully integrated cloud based communication system that aligns surgeons and engineers to optimize patient outcomes.
- Streamlined communication between surgeon and engineers via website and app
- Incorporates real time visualization of 3D implant and patient anatomy
- Immediate access to patient specific implant design, manufacturing, and delivery status
